Webb26 juli 2024 · Brain Definition. The brain is an organ that coordinates nervous system function in vertebrate and most invertebrate animals. The brain is typically located inside the head, within a protective covering such as an exoskeleton or skull. In humans, the brain weighs about three pounds and consumes a stunning 20-25% of all the body’s energy! Webb21 sep. 2024 · The average cat’s brain weighs in at a mere 30 grams or about 0.06 pounds. Compare that to a great white shark’s brain which is only a little heavier at 34 grams (0.07 pounds) or a newborn baby’s brain—which is already over eleven times as heavy as a cat’s brain at 350 grams (0.77 pounds). (2) WebbBrain-body size relationship. Brain size usually increases with body size in animals (is positively correlated), i.e. large animals usually have larger brains than smaller animals. The relationship is not linear however. Small mammals like mice have a direct brain/body size similar to humans, while elephants have comparatively small brain/body size, …

Webb23 sep. 2016 · The heaviest human brain ever recorded according to Guinness was of a 30-year-old US male which weighed 2.3 kg. The record was first reported in 1992 and remains unbroken since then. In comparison, the brain of an average man weighs about 1.4 kg whereas Albert Einstein's brain reportedly weighed slightly below average at 1.23 kg. …
